Navigate to the Advanced Graphics tab, checkmark Enable Rective Flushing, Use asynchronous shader building (Hack), Use Fast GPU Time (Hack), and Use Vulkan pipeline cache. After that, set Anisotropic Filtering to Default and press the OK button. These settings will give you the best performance even on your low-end PCs..

ADMIN MOD. Best settings for Metroid Prime Remaster. Use Accurate CPU accuracy in Emulation > Configure > CPU. This solves most issues, including crashes, terrible audio, etc. AMD RDNA1/RDNA2 Radeon users, enable "Force maximum clocks" in Emulation > Configure > Graphics > Advanced. Here are my specs, Core I5-12400F RTX 4060 Ti 8GB 16 GB Ram. 0. charmeck.org inmate inquiry In the advanced tab: Accuracy on High. ASTC recompression on uncompressed, you have the VRAM for it. Enable asynchronous presentation disabled. totk doesn't like it. Force maximum clocks enabled. This one is critical for RDNA2. Enable reactive flushing enabled, required for some graphics, photos for example. My rig is a i9-9900K with a 4090 FE (I know that CPU needs a upgrade) My brother can run the game just fine with his 13900K. terry funeral home obituaries talladega alabama Slowdown (low framerate) fixes in Yuzu: Turn off V-sync in the emulator. For Yuzu: emulation, configure, graphics, advanced, uncheck "Use Vsync (Open GL Only)" Click OK button to save. Create an application profile to enable V-Sync and Triple Buffering from the GPU software instead.
